Amazon has reported the fastest growth for its cloud division since 2021.
Amazon Web Services (AWS) reported $42.2 billion in revenue for the quarter, up on the $40.54bn expected by Wall Street, and a 36.7 percent year-over-year jump. The company as a whole reported $200.61bn in revenue, up 20 percent.
The cloud subsidiary reported $16.62bn in second-quarter operating income, and a 36.8 percent operating margin for the second quarter.
AWS' specific AI division has exceeded a $25 billion annual revenue run rate, as has the company's chips business.
